So we're back from the vet and it turns out that Gabriel has an aneurysm, just underneath his lungs in his upper abdomen. which is an excessive localized enlargement of an artery caused by a weakening of the artery wall. There's nothing the vet can do, she said surgery could cause it to pop, which means Gabriel could bleed out. So it's a waiting game to see if it could possibly reduce over time. My vet took a blood test as a baseline, and also to make sure his results are all normal. She'll leave me a message when they come in. If I need to I can get into the vet on Monday am.
